Transaction ccacfb301f17005afb19f21c7c68e8e76884d72638408ea02585a712f074b3ec

1 Input
2 Outputs
  • ccacfb301f17005afb19f21c7c68e8e76884d72638408ea02585a712f074b3ec:0
  • value  222570
    address  1E7HMZdMppLDqCkhUMjy2EYbrTNWrUNo7J
  • ccacfb301f17005afb19f21c7c68e8e76884d72638408ea02585a712f074b3ec:1
  • value  13394166
    address  3K5XTbo9BeiGDmbbDH9cX42Z4NArC9WgRa